/*
* @test
* @bug 4513976
* @summary tests that inter-JVM image transfer doesn't cause crash
* @key headful
* @library /test/lib
* @run main ImageTransferCrashTest
*/
import java.awt.Toolkit;
import java.awt.datatransfer.Clipboard;
import java.awt.datatransfer.ClipboardOwner;
import java.awt.datatransfer.DataFlavor;
import java.awt.datatransfer.StringSelection;
import java.awt.datatransfer.Transferable;
import java.awt.datatransfer.UnsupportedFlavorException;
import java.awt.image.BufferedImage;
import java.awt.image.WritableRaster;
import java.io.IOException;
import java.util.concurrent.TimeUnit;
import java.util.concurrent.TimeoutException;
import jdk.test.lib.process.OutputAnalyzer;
import jdk.test.lib.process.ProcessTools;
public class ImageTransferCrashTest implements ClipboardOwner {
static final Clipboard clipboard =
Toolkit.getDefaultToolkit().getSystemClipboard();
final Transferable textTransferable = new StringSelection("TEXT");
public static final int CLIPBOARD_DELAY = 10;
public static void main(String[] args) throws Exception {
if (args.length == 0) {
ImageTransferCrashTest imageTransferCrashTest = new ImageTransferCrashTest();
imageTransferCrashTest.initialize();
return;
}
final ClipboardOwner clipboardOwner = (clip, contents) -> System.exit(0);
final int width = 100;
final int height = 100;
final BufferedImage bufferedImage =
new BufferedImage(width, height, BufferedImage.TYPE_INT_RGB);
final WritableRaster writableRaster =
bufferedImage.getWritableTile(0, 0);
final int[] color = new int[]{0x80, 0x80, 0x80};
for (int i = 0; i < width; i++) {
for (int j = 0; j < height; j++) {
writableRaster.setPixel(i, j, color);
}
}
bufferedImage.releaseWritableTile(0, 0);
final Transferable imageTransferable = new Transferable() {
final DataFlavor[] flavors = new DataFlavor[]{
DataFlavor.imageFlavor};
public DataFlavor[] getTransferDataFlavors() {
return flavors;
}
public boolean isDataFlavorSupported(DataFlavor df) {
return DataFlavor.imageFlavor.equals(df);
}
public Object getTransferData(DataFlavor df)
throws UnsupportedFlavorException {
if (!isDataFlavorSupported(df)) {
throw new UnsupportedFlavorException(df);
}
return bufferedImage;
}
};
clipboard.setContents(imageTransferable, clipboardOwner);
final Object o = new Object();
synchronized (o) {
try {
o.wait();
} catch (InterruptedException ie) {
ie.printStackTrace();
}
}
System.out.println("Test Pass!");
}
public void initialize() throws Exception {
clipboard.setContents(textTransferable, this);
ProcessBuilder pb = ProcessTools.createTestJavaProcessBuilder(
ImageTransferCrashTest.class.getName(),
"child"
);
Process process = ProcessTools.startProcess("Child", pb);
OutputAnalyzer outputAnalyzer = new OutputAnalyzer(process);
if (!process.waitFor(15, TimeUnit.SECONDS)) {
process.destroyForcibly();
throw new TimeoutException("Timed out waiting for Child");
}
outputAnalyzer.shouldHaveExitValue(0);
}
public void lostOwnership(Clipboard clip, Transferable contents) {
final Runnable r = () -> {
while (true) {
try {
Thread.sleep(CLIPBOARD_DELAY);
Transferable t = clipboard.getContents(null);
t.getTransferData(DataFlavor.imageFlavor);
} catch (IllegalStateException e) {
e.printStackTrace();
System.err.println("clipboard is not prepared yet");
continue;
} catch (Exception e) {
e.printStackTrace();
}
break;
}
clipboard.setContents(textTransferable, null);
};
final Thread t = new Thread(r);
t.start();
}
}
